This Is a great example of a late 18th century Cossack ball butt pistol. It is just over 13" overall in length with a European proofed 9" barrel from much earlier. You can clearly see the original tang hole, now plugged, as well as its original European engraving and cannon type muzzle. The ENTIRE wood stock totally covered in the most gorgeous brass and mother of pearl inlays almost defying description. Steel button trigger,
